The average rent in Esperance is $2,295 per month as of September 2026. This is 21% above the national average rent, or $395 more per month.

Average rent prices in Esperance have decreased by 15% over the last month and have decreased by 8% since last year.

Rent prices in Esperance vary by bedroom size, rental type, and neighborhood. The average rent for an apartment in Esperance is $1,950, whereas a house costs $3,200. 1-bedroom apartments in Esperance run $1,695 on average, while 2-bedroom apartments are $1,925.

Frequently asked questions for Esperance, Esperance, WA

Quick answers to common questions about the Esperance rental market.

How much is rent in Esperance?

The average rent in Esperance is $2,295 per month as of September 5, 2026.

Is rent up or down in Esperance?

Average rent prices in Esperance have decreased by 15% over the last month and have decreased by 8% since last year.

How does Esperance rent compare to the national average?

Rent in Esperance is 21% above the national average, which means renters are paying approximately $395 more per month.

What salary do I need to afford rent in Esperance?

To comfortably afford rent in Esperance, you'd need to earn approximately $92,000/year, based on spending no more than 30% of your income on rent.

Methodology

Rent prices are based on Zumper's rental listings from the past 30 days. Median rent is calculated across all available listings and property types on the platform. If you filter the page by bedroom count or property type, the pricing throughout the page will update automatically to reflect that segment of the rental market.

Household and population data come from the U.S. Census Bureau. Cost-of-living data is sourced from the Council for Community and Economic Research's Cost of Living Index (COLI).
